Re: Strange question - tabbed/slotta modern military minis in 28-32mm?
« Reply #5 on: 13 June 2011, 03:19:46 PM »
Everything else from Black Scorpion is tabbed so I'd expect they are too.

Vexilia sell the D&P modern Italians and French which are also on slotta tabs.

Whoever is now selling the Tactical Miniatures range (definately available as I've seen them somewhere) has their modern police, hostages and terrorists which are also on slotta tabs.
